South Africa - Online Register with Unemployment Insurance Fund

- Step 7 : You will receive a profile activation link and temporary user credentials through your selected contact method.
- Step 8 : Note the credentials and click on the link to activate your account. Your registration will be successful and you should be logging in using the temporary user credentials, in the page that opens.
- Step 9 : You will have to change the password on your first login after registration for security purposes. In the “Password change Required” page, enter the new password and hint for your password, then click “Apply” button.
- Step 10 : For security reasons, you will then have to complete a screening process by confirming certain information about yourself, which will be compared to the data available to the Department of Labour. Click “Continue” button on the message and proceed.
- Step 11 : Answer all the questions carefully and if you fail at any stage of process, an error message will be displayed as “vetting failed”. In such a case, uFiling support should be sought by clicking “UIF Services Support” option.
- Step 12 : Once you successfully completed vetting, you will be directed to a page where you can update your personal details before you can proceed to the uFiling website. After updating click “Update” button to proceed.
- Step 13 : On the left side menu, select ”Register” button under ‘Registrations’ tab and select the type of Employer you want to get registered as and click on “Register” button at the bottom on the right corner.
- Step 14 : Proceed to complete the further steps by providing appropriate information under each tab. You will have to complete tabs like Qualification Criteria, Employer Details, Declaration, Employment details and Beneficiary details to complete registration.
- Step 15 : You will receive an email from the Department of Labour with the UI number for the new employer once the registration application was processed successfully.
